Understanding Exilis Treatment
Exilis is a non-invasive cosmetic treatment that uses radiofrequency energy to tighten skin and reduce fat. It is commonly used in Dublin for facial rejuvenation and body contouring. The procedure involves delivering controlled heat to the targeted areas, which stimulates collagen production and improves skin elasticity. Patients typically experience minimal downtime, making it a popular choice for those seeking cosmetic enhancements without surgery.

Timing Your Beef Consumption
There is no specific timeframe within which you must avoid beef after Exilis treatment. However, it is advisable to wait until any initial discomfort or redness has subsided. This usually takes a few hours to a couple of days. Once you feel comfortable, you can resume your normal diet, including beef. It is always a good idea to consult with your healthcare provider or the professional who performed the Exilis treatment to get personalized advice.
